Wildman, I am not at all suprised by the random failures you are seeing after a "EMP" event. Todays electronics can fail, then "heal", only to fail again later.

I consider any electronics that have suffered such an event as unreliable and in need of replacement, especially if it is a life safety item.

I have attended many technical classes on static discharge and service work techniques that demonstrate the failure/heal cycle. Even improper touching of some components will cause changes to many components. Think about the problems in creating a static free workstation.

I strongly suggest that any equipment that suffered a failure and is now working be removed from service. Even competent repair technicians can not diagnose and prove safe equipment that has undergone a high static discharge event.
